Democracy Hub is calling on President John Dramani Mahama to take urgent action, demanding the immediate release of the full Constitution Review Committee report as well as a clear, time-bound roadmap for constitutional reforms.
Speaking at a press briefing in Accra on Tuesday, April 21, the Director of Policy and Research at Democracy Hub, Kirchuffs Atengble, said the Youth Platform on Constitutional Reform is pushing for transparency and swift implementation of the proposed changes.
He argued that the release of only a summary report is not enough to enable meaningful public engagement.
He noted that while the group conditionally supports key proposals—including lowering the presidential age requirement, capping ministerial appointments, restructuring the judiciary, and strengthening decentralisation—its support depends on the publication of the full report, broad national consultations, and concrete implementation steps to avoid another stalled reform process.
“We demand that the government publish the full unabridged report of the Constitutional Review Committee, without further delay and reduction as indicated earlier,” he said.
